Can You Run Pvc For Dryer Vent. Pvc dryer vents are affordable and easy to install, but they are not fire retardant and may emit toxic fumes. Pvc is not recommended for dryer vents as it can catch fire, release toxic fumes and clog easily. Can you use pvc for a dryer vent? Learn about the pros and cons of pvc and other. The pipe may soften, melt, or in extreme cases, burn. Learn about the types, sizes, and risks of using pvc for dryer vents and how to install. Residential clothes dryers can produce air temperatures in the vent system that can compromise the structural integrity of the pvc pipe. Using the proper materials for dryer vents is crucial to ensure effective ventilation and prevent fire hazards. Pvc pipe is not suitable for dryer vents due to its relatively low operating temperature maximum. When it comes to dryer vents, it’s important to follow. It is generally not advisable to use pvc pipe for the entire length of your dryer vent, especially if it is a long vent.
